    From the Academic year 2020, there will be no more AIIMS MBBS and JIPMER MBBS. NEET will be the sole entrance exam for admission to Medical, Dental, Ayush and Veterinary courses across India. Now it is mandatory to qualify NEET even if you want to go abroad to study MBBS.

    Since it is NTA that is conducting the exam and not AIIMS, ther e would be only questions from Physics, Chemistry and Biology. So if you want to practise AIIMS previous papers, skip Logical reasoning and English and focus solely on Physics, Chemistry and Biology sections.

    AIIMS Delhi is a mix of legacy and tech. You get 24/7 library access, world-class robotic surgery labs and single rooms for ₹30/month. The new Mother & Child and Surgery blocks are now fully functional.
